Overview of the IELTS Academic Test

The Ielts Test Uzbekistan Academic test evaluates a candidate's efficiency in four key areas: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. Each section is created to evaluate the candidate's capability to use English in an academic environment efficiently. Below is a breakdown of the test format:

SectionPeriodJobsScoring
Listening30 minutes4 sections, 40 productsBand rating (0-9)
Reading60 minutes3 areas, 40 itemsBand score (0-9)
Writing60 minutes2 jobsBand score (0-9)
Speaking11-14 minutes3 partsBand score (0-9)

Test Dates and Locations in Uzbekistan

IELTS tests are conducted regularly throughout the year in various cities in Uzbekistan. Major cities such as Tashkent, Samarkand, and Bukhara usually host the evaluation. Candidates ought to check the official British Council or IDP Education websites for specific test dates and locations.

Preparation Tips for IELTS Academic

Getting ready for the IELTS Academic test requires a structured approach. Here are some techniques to think about:

1. Comprehend the Test Format

Familiarize yourself with the structure of each section. Knowing what to anticipate can relieve anxiety and permit more focused studying.

2. Use Official IELTS Preparation Materials

Purchase main Ielts Coaching Uzbekistan research study products and practice tests. Resources from the British Council and IDP offer genuine test concerns and answers.

3. Construct a Study Schedule

Produce a dedicated study timetable that allocates sufficient time for each section of the test. Consistency is type in language learning.

4. Participate In English Daily

Immerse yourself in the English language through reading scholastic short articles, enjoying English movies, and talking with proficient speakers.

5. Take Practice Tests

Routinely taking full-length practice tests helps determine progress. It also hones time management abilities, which are vital during the real exam.

6. Sign Up With Study Groups or Classes

Working together with others can boost motivation and provide assistance. Consider enrolling in an IELTS preparation course readily available in Uzbekistan.

7. Look for Feedback

If possible, seek advice from an instructor or tutor to get feedback on composing and speaking jobs. Useful criticism can help improve performance.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. What is the minimum IELTS rating required for universities?

The minimum rating typically needed varies by organization and program however generally ranges from 6.0 to 7.5 for undergraduate and postgraduate courses.

2. How long is the IELTS score legitimate?

IELTS scores stand for 2 years. After this duration, candidates need to retake the test to renew their ratings.

3. Can I take the IELTS test online in Uzbekistan?

As of now, the IELTS test is generally taken in person, however online test choices may be available in particular scenarios, such as during COVID-19 restrictions. Talk to the official test centers for updates.

4. How do I sign up for the IELTS Academic test?

Candidates can register for the IELTS Academic test online through the official British Council or IDP Education websites. Payment is required at the time of registration.

5. What if I need unique accommodations for the test?

Prospects who require unique accommodations should contact their test center ahead of time to talk about available choices and make necessary plans.
